Pair of scores in loss Evans hauled in three of nine targets for 50 yards and two touchdowns in the Buccaneers' 27-24 loss to the Chiefs on Sunday.
Impact Evans certainly made the most of his handful of receptions, and he even fought through what appeared to be an ankle issue that caused him to limp off for a play in the second half. The big wideout's connection with Tom Brady wasn't operating on all cylinders, however, as evidenced by both his poor catch rate and the fact Brady's second interception of the day came on a pass intended for Evans in which there appeared to be some degree of miscommunication. Nevertheless, fantasy managers walked away pleased with the pair of end-zone trips, which extended Evans' scoring streak to three games and left the seven-year veteran just one touchdown away from equaling the career-high 12 he's notched in two other seasons. Evans will look to carry over his momentum into a Week 14 battle against the Vikings after resting up over the Buccaneers' Week 13 bye.

Scores despite tough matchup Evans caught five of nine targets for 49 yards and a touchdown in Monday night's 27-24 loss to the Rams.
Impact Evans showed great power and determination as he took a short pass and dragged two opponents into the end zone for a nine-yard score to start the second quarter. That play came on one of the rare occasions Evans didn't draw coverage from opposing cornerback Jalen Ramsey, who he battled with all evening. Despite the tough matchup, Evans held his own and caused a couple pass interference calls on Ramsey in the first half. More importantly, he built his touchdown tally to nine this season, compensating for another game with only decent yardage. Next up for Evans is what could be a high-scoring encounter with the Chiefs this Sunday.

Bounce-back week in store? Evans could be set for a resurgent Week 8 performance Monday night against the Giants with Chris Godwin (finger) ruled out for the contest.
Impact Jenna Laine of ESPN.com confirms Godwin fractured his index finger on his fourth-quarter touchdown reception in Sunday's win over the Raiders and will be forced to miss Week 8 at minimum. Evans has logged just four targets combined over the last pair of contests as he struggles to overcome a lingering ankle injury, but the combination of Godwin's absence and the extra day to heal up ahead of the Week 8 contest should leave him poised for a boost in opportunity and production. In the three games Godwin has already missed this season due to a concussion and a hamstring injury, Evans has notably eclipsed 100 yards receiving in two of them and logged a combined 27 targets overall.
